#954a56 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#954a56 is composed of 58.4% red, 29%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 350.4 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 43.7%. #954a56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ff94ac with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#954a56 color description : Dark moderate red.

#954a56 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#954a56 has RGB values of R:149, G:74,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.42,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9783894.

Shades and Tints of #954a56

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#954a56

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736c6d is the less saturated color, while #da0527 is the most saturated one.
